Colloquial form of 'という' used for quoting, naming, or explaining; very common in spoken Japanese.
彼、昨日来るっていうよ。
They say he's coming tomorrow.
これは『みかん』っていう果物です。
This fruit is called a 'mikan' (mandarin).
要するに、彼は忙しいっていうことだ。
In short, it means he's busy.
その店、安いっていう噂があるけど本当かな?
There's a rumor that the shop is cheap, but is it true?
